Trader Motor Yachts' most successful model, the Trader 42 Signature has undergone a comprehensive reinvention and the new version has been unveiled at this year’s Southampton Boat Show.
The Trader 42 Signature is a landmark model in the 35-year history of the Trader brand and has become one of the most popular craft in her class. The semi-displacement cruiser has a hull designed by renowned naval architect Tony Castro and is CE category A rated. This exceptionally versatile passagemaker can be run by a couple and accommodate six in comfort.
With one standard Trader 42 Signature having been selected as the motor yacht of choice by the Cruising Club of Switzerland and clocking up over 40,000 miles at sea over five years, her cruising credentials are well proven. As well as being very accomplished on the open water, the 3.5m air-draft of the standard boat opens up inland waterways, including routes through France to the Mediterranean.
This year’s updates to the Trader 42 Signature are all designed to further develop the Trader 42 Signature’s appeal as a cruising yacht and a home afloat. There are over 120 enhancements to the boat on board, focused on comfort, ease of use and refinement. The development program has been informed extensive feedback from owners as well as making use of the best technologies and equipment now available.
The new glazing features enhance the Trader 42 Signature’s purposeful exterior lines while also delivering outstanding sea views from the interior - with an impressive 15ft2 of glazing in the master suite alone. Life on board also benefits from a new central heating system which provides far greater versatility then conventional methods.
Underway, a docking joystick which controls the propellers and bow thruster delivers unrivalled manoeuvering control. The system has been developed by Cummins and is matched to their latest 6.7 QSB power units, now offered in ratings up to 480hp per engine for 25 knot top speeds. Noise and refinement levels are greatly reduced by a new proprietary underwater exhaust and the Sea Torque enclosed shaft system that isolates the engines from the propeller thrust, allowing much softer engine mounts to be used. Zero speed stabilizers are also now available as an option.
The Trader 42 Signature is available with numerous internal and external options for personalization including convertible soft top, hardtop or flybridge and two or three stateroom layouts. All variants feel remarkably spacious and demonstrate the Trader “home from home” design philosophy. A comprehensive cruising inventory is specified as standard, including domestic appliances, generator and navigation suite.

Trader 42 Signature
Specifications:
Length Overall 13.3 m
Beam 4.3 m
Air Draft (mast down) 3.5 m
Displacement (light) 14,000 kg
RCD Category A
Price: From £475,000 ex VAT, with twin CUMMINS QSB6.7 @ 380hp
